Trolling is disingenuously advocating a position just to rile people up. Those folks actually believe what they’re saying.

To wit:
Rush Limbaugh is a big, fat, ugly jerk! [Ranting, not trolling.]
Them Irish babies is gooood eatin’! [Trolling.]
